Life insurers tweak products, incentives to protect margins after IRDAI’s new surrender rules

Private life insurers in India have strategized to adhere to new IRDAI regulations requiring surrender value from the first year on non-participating policies. Companies like HDFC Life, ICICI Prudential Life, and SBI Life are adjusting their commission structures and product mixes to protect margins and maintain growth despite the regulatory changes. Private life insurers in India have strategized to adhere to new IRDAI regulations requiring surrender value from the first year on non-participating policies.
